#e56eb4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e56eb4 is composed of 89.8% red, 43.1% green and 70.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 52% magenta, 21.4%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 324.7 degrees, a saturation of 69.6% and a lightness of 66.5%. #e56eb4 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ffdcff with #cb0069. Closest websafe color is: #cc66cc.

#e56eb4 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#e56eb4 has RGB values of R:229, G:110, B:180 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.52, Y:0.21,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15036084.

Hex triplet e56eb4 #e56eb4
RGB Decimal 229, 110, 180 rgb(229,110,180)
RGB Percent 89.8, 43.1, 70.6 rgb(89.8%,43.1%,70.6%)
CMYK 0, 52, 21, 10
HSL 324.7°, 69.6, 66.5 hsl(324.7,69.6%,66.5%)
HSV (or HSB) 324.7°, 52, 89.8
Web Safe cc66cc #cc66cc
CIE-LAB 62.599, 54.136, -15.369
XYZ 46.127, 31.108, 46.753
xyY 0.372, 0.251, 31.108
CIE-LCH 62.599, 56.276, 344.151
CIE-LUV 62.599, 68.937, -32.219
Hunter-Lab 55.775, 50.018, -10.657
Binary 11100101, 01101110, 10110100

Shades and Tints of #e56eb4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050103 is the darkest color, while #fdf3f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e56eb4

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#aaa9aa is the less saturated color, while #f95ab7 is the most saturated one.
